How much is a used sailboat worth?

How much is a used sailboat worth?

The average price of used sailboats is around $21,000, but new boats cost $60,000 on average and upwards. Some used boats can be purchased for less than $10,000, depending on their age, size, and condition. This is because pre-owned sailboats have about 80 percent of the market share.

Should you test drive a used boat before buying?

You will always want to see the boat and drive it prior to purchasing the boat. Most boat sellers will meet you at the water so you can take a test run. If they do not have time for you or you do not feel comfortable buying the boat without a test run, walk away.

What is the best time of year to buy a boat?

FALL. Many people will argue that the fall is the best time for buying a boat. This is because most of the manufacturers start offering discounts around September and October. When demand begins to decline, dealers often provide incentives for buyers in the form of discounts and deep cuts in pricing.

What kind of boat is a Sun Cat?

2004 Com-Pac Sun Cat Clark Mills wanted to design a shoal daysailer that would rig and sail easily, quickly, and comfortably as well as accommodate his family and friends. The Sun Cat was designed as an easily driven, roomy day boat with a shoal draft to gunk hole along coasts and in harbors not accessible to more burdensome yachts.

Why buy a Sun Cat?

Easy to rig, easy to handle, cruises through very shallow water. This is simply a fun big little boat. The Sun Cat is a 17ft cat gaff rig sailboat. It has a shallow draft, a large, comfortable cockpit, and a comfortable cabin that has two berths. It’s a very comfortable and safe boat that is easy to tow, set up, launch, sail, and retrieve.
